Throughput of the port’s largest terminal Kwai Tsing fell by 11.5%
In January-November 2022, port Hong Kong (China) handled 15.18 million TEUs (-6.9%, year-on-year). According to the port authority, the port’s largest terminal Kwai Tsing handled 11.86 million TEUs (-11.5%, year-on-year), other terminals handled 3.32 million TEUs (+14.1%).
Port Hong Kong is one of the world’s largest ports. It is capable of handling 456,000 vessels per year. In 2021, the port’s container throughput totaled 17.8 million TEUs.
